Kaligrāfija

Etymology edit

Via other European languages, ultimately borrowed from Ancient Greek καλλιγραφία (kalligraphía, pretty writing), from κάλλος (kállos, beauty) and γράφω (gráphō, to draw), adapted to Latvian lexical patterns ( +‎ -ija).

Pronunciation edit

(file)

Noun edit

kaligrāfija f (4th declension)

  1. calligraphy, penmanship (the practice of handwriting in a beautiful, decorative style; words written in such a style)
    kaligrāfijas skolotājscalligraphy teacher
    kaligrāfijas nodarbībacalligraphy lesson
    kaligrāfija 24 stundāscalligraphy in 24 hours
    ķīniešu kaligrāfijaChinese calligraphy
    kaligrāfija atkal nāk modēcalligraphy is again fashionable
